We are seeking a Senior Hydropower Engineer with a minimum of 10 years experience in the structural design of hydro power plants and water related structures.

The job will entail the analysis and design of all related structural components for intakes and powerhouses, preparation of technical specifications for construction contracts and review of construction submittals. Knowledge of dam safety and finite element analysis, particularly past experience with the ADINA finite element program would be advantageous. In addition, previous experience in the design and seismic upgrade of highway bridges would be advantageous.

Rounding out your profile are proven project management, interpersonal and oral/written communication skills, and ability to work in a project team. This position will involve proposal writing in addition to the primary technical role. This position may require travel around Canada and possibly overseas.

 

Our portfolio of projects (Calgary Office) includes: water supply dams, tailings dams, hydraulic structures, drainage channels, irrigation canals, flood control dykes, stormwater management infrastructure, and hydro power facilities.
